Watercolors by Judith Bodnar

 

Biography / Artist Statement

 

I primarily paint landscapes and nature. This work reflects a passion for the outdoor experience that I enjoy so much. Through the use of vivid color, the emotional connection I have with the beauty of Maine’s natural surroundings is evoked. My landscape and nature work has an impressionistic quality, vibrancy and pureness of color. I also create abstract paintings that suggest the surreal and the whimsical. I hope to share an emotional passion with the viewer through use of color and flight of fancy, imparting feelings of optimism, serenity and love of life.

While I am primarily self taught, I have also studied with professional artists Ida Dengrove of New Jersey and the following Maine Artists: Maude Olsen, Katharina Keoughan, Jan Kilburn and Julie Babb. My work in Art has been a life long interest. I seriously started watercolor painting as an emotional outlet for the expression of intense emotion experienced in my professional work as a Licensed Clinical Social Worker in Cancer Care and Hospice Care in New Jersey. Now retired in Maine, I am able to pursue the medium of watercolor full time.
